Abstract

It the utility model is related to a kind of three flour scrapper conveyors, including the first scrapper conveyor, the second scrapper conveyor and the 3rd scrapper conveyor being set up in parallel, first scrapper conveyor, the second scrapper conveyor and the 3rd scrapper conveyor include head, middle transportation section and tail, the first drive chain wheel shaft, the second drive chain wheel shaft and the 3rd drive chain wheel shaft are respectively equipped with head, the first drive sprocket is installed on first drive chain wheel shaft, second drive sprocket is installed on the second drive chain wheel shaft, the 3rd drive sprocket is installed on the 3rd drive chain wheel shaft;The first tail sprocket wheel, the second tail sprocket wheel and the 3rd tail sprocket wheel are respectively equipped with tail, first drive sprocket and the first tail sprocket wheel, the second drive sprocket and the second tail sprocket wheel, and the 3rd install around chain between drive sprocket and the 3rd tail sprocket wheel respectively, scraper plate is installed on chain.The three flour scrapper conveyor can realize that three scrapper conveyors work independently, and meet the requirement of technique processing, reduce flour residual, reduce energy consumption.

Background technology
Horizontal feed is carried out to semi-finished product or final flour in fluor producing process and mainly uses screw auger and scraper plate Machine, and in wheat flour milling workshop section, with the raising being continuously increased with technique process technology of wall scroll production line output, high side multideck screen It is continuously increased with the usage quantity of wheat flour purifier, same floor mileage platform high side multideck screen screens out the material for the different fineness grade come, It is required for delivering into wheat flour purifier again after according to technological requirement collecting and screen or mills again, is nearly all to use three spiral shells now Auger is revolved to undertake the effect of total powder auger.But due to being now to ask material fed distance increasingly longer, up to tens of meters Moment of torsion in the operating of packing auger blade axle is very big, and especially problem is more obvious on startup, so the reducing motor selected is also more next Bigger, the problem of power consumption is big, becomes increasingly conspicuous;Moreover, to avoid the travelling grazing casing of long distance delivery screw-conveyer-shaft, blade and casing Gap have to be put into 5-10mm, another serious problems for so causing screw auger are exactly along auger whole length direction Bottom flour residual quantity is very big, not only causes the conveyance loss of material, and cleaning is wasted time and energy, and as cleared up not in time, holds Easily cause the cross pollution between different material, easily go mouldy with it is infested, directly affects the food security of flour, this Be flour mill the most headache the problem of.
In scrapper conveyor work of the prior art, machine head chain wheel axle and tail sprocket shaft rotate and drive chain to advance, Chain turns at machine head chain wheel axle and tail sprocket shaft respectively, realizes continuous cycle operation, scraper plate is in chain Material is delivered to discharging opening discharge from charging aperture under drive.Tail sprocket shaft can be affected by adjusting hanging screw and hanging tight nut Move in the horizontal direction, so as to change the centre-to-centre spacing between machine head chain wheel axle and tail sprocket shaft, chain is kept appropriate Tension force.Scrapper conveyor is because the popularization of scraper plate high polymer material is plus being chain drive, and conveying capacity is strong, and scraper plate is in chain-driving Directly contacted with bottom of shell down, gapless, bottom flour residual quantity very little, therefore the advantage in flour long distance delivery is got over Come more obvious.
The country is currently without three integral type flour scrapper conveyors, although some producers are replaced with 3 independent scrapper conveyors Generation universal three total powder screw augers at present, but due to 3 scrapper conveyors by every equipment transmission device, tensioning apparatus Limitation, plus that must reserve certain operation and safe distance between every equipment, the position that plane occupies is very big, this for All it is extremely difficult arrangement for the technology arrangement of the production line of most of newly-built and existing transformation, because, 3 scrapper conveyors If inlet and outlet position can not concentrate, the intersection of story height side's tens of pipelines of plansifter screenings is directly affected, can not be ensured The angle of every pipeline meets flour angle of repose requirement, and material will block in expects pipe, as a same reason, into scrapper conveyor Material can not be also assigned to flour angle of repose in the wheat flour purifier of next floor.Thus, there is an urgent need to have a kind of volume tight Gather, three integral type scrapper conveyors rational in infrastructure meet that flour collects, conveyed and the technological requirement of discharging.
